Rajalingam Manickavasan delivered his 27th Social Media Marketing workshop
Rajalingam Manickavasan, a renowned social media consultant / trainer and also the founder of toss digiconsult a social media agency in Chennai conducted the agency’s 27th workshop on Social Media Marketing on 27th of March 2016 at Hotel Courtyard Marriott in Chennai.
Mr.Rajalingam Manickavasan, a social media consultant & trainer/ founder of toss digiconsult said, “There is also a significant gap in demand and supply of digital marketers today. The gap between digital marketing jobs and skills is exactly what we are addressing through our workshops. Our vision is to educate those who want to understand, experience and implement the tools of this trade.”
The workshop covered topics such as why Social Media Marketing should be integrated with the overall IMC Plan and the ways a brand can be promoted on social media were discussed. The importance of business owners having knowledge about what and what not to be used when it comes to Social Media Marketing was stressed in the workshop.
Speaking about the workshop, Rajalingam Manickavasan said “The main idea behind the workshop was to teach the importance of social media marketing in meeting the marketing goals and objectives of a brand, and also to help the brand managers and brand owners make informed decisions about how to incorporate social media marketing in their marketing plan”.
The aim of this workshop was to enable business owners, marketing professionals and students to master Social Media Marketing to promote, build and manage their brands in the ever-growing social media channels. It was attended by CEOs, Entrepreneurs, Small Business Owners, Marketing and Communication professionals and students.
